McAllen mariachi band released from ICE custody to open for Kacey Musgraves at Gruene Hall
Members of a mariachi band from McAllen, who were once detained in U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) custody, are now scheduled to open for country music star Kasey Musgraves at multiple concerts in the Texas Hill Country. “The Mariachi Brothers” and Musgraves will perform at Gruene Hall in New Braunfels from May 3-5, according to the venue’s website. Kacey Musgraves to play shows with recently detained mariachi players
Two months ago, the Gámez-Cuéllar family’s routine check-in with Texas immigration officials turned into an ICE detainment. The backlash was swift and bipartisan, with Democrat politicians immediately leading the charge and calling for the release of the family of five, which included two award-winning high-school mariachi band members.
